Is Fernleaf Yarrow deer resistant?
Achillea filipendulina

Damage step 2 of 4 · Seldom Severely Damaged
Mostly. Light browsing at worst; rarely ruined.
Damage steps follow a published university field scale. How plants are rated.
About Fernleaf Yarrow
Taller and stiffer than common yarrow, with mustard-yellow plates that dry well and need no staking. Aromatic ferny foliage keeps deer off.

Common questions about Fernleaf Yarrow
- Is Fernleaf Yarrow deer resistant?
- Fernleaf Yarrow (Achillea filipendulina) is rated Seldom Severely Damaged, step 2 of 4 on the damage scale this site uses. Light browsing at worst; rarely ruined.
- What hardiness zones does Fernleaf Yarrow grow in?
- Fernleaf Yarrow is hardy in USDA zones 3 to 9. Outside that range it will either not survive winter or will struggle with summer heat.
- Does Fernleaf Yarrow grow in shade?
- No. Fernleaf Yarrow wants full sun and will grow thin and flop in shade.
- How big does Fernleaf Yarrow get?
- Mature height is roughly 36–48 in. Growth rate is fast.
